Why GPS trackers are essential for golden retrievers in rural settings
Golden Retrievers are known for their friendly and curious nature, often exploring vast outdoor spaces with boundless energy. In rural settings, these areas can be expansive and sometimes challenging to navigate, increasing the risk of your dog getting lost. Using a GPS dog tracker provides a reliable way to monitor your Golden’s location in real time, offering peace of mind.
Unlike urban environments, rural landscapes may lack clear boundaries, making it easy for dogs to wander far. A GPS tracker ensures you can quickly locate your pet even if they venture beyond your property. This technology helps safeguard your dog from dangers such as wildlife encounters, traffic, or harsh weather.
GPS trackers offer continuous location updates, allowing you to set safe zones and receive alerts if your dog leaves these areas. This proactive feature significantly reduces the time and stress involved in searching for a lost pet, enhancing your Golden’s safety during outdoor adventures.
Key features to look for in the best gps dog tracker for Goldens
When choosing the best GPS dog tracker for Goldens, several key features should be considered to ensure it meets the needs of your energetic and adventurous pet. Accuracy and real-time tracking are essential, allowing you to know your dog’s precise location at all times, especially in rural areas where signals can be tricky.
Durability is another crucial factor. Look for trackers made with waterproof and rugged materials, as Golden Retrievers love to explore water and rough terrain. This ensures the device withstands various weather conditions and physical impacts.
Battery life and connectivity
Long battery life is vital for extended outings or when your dog is away from home for long periods. Devices offering at least 24 to 48 hours of use without frequent charging are preferred. Connectivity options like cellular networks or satellite support can enhance tracking range and reliability.
Additional features such as geo-fencing allow you to set safe zones and receive alerts if your Golden leaves these boundaries. Some trackers also include activity monitoring to help you keep an eye on your dog’s health and exercise.
Ease of use and app interface quality matter too. A user-friendly mobile app with clear maps and notification options can make it simpler to manage tracking and alerts effectively.
How to set up and use a gps dog tracker effectively in open areas
Setting up and using a GPS dog tracker effectively in open areas ensures you can monitor your Golden Retriever’s location accurately and keep them safe. The process begins with selecting a tracker that suits your needs and includes clear instructions for activation.
Step-by-step setup process
- Charge the GPS tracker fully before first use to ensure maximum battery life.
- Download the official app provided by the tracker’s developer, available on Android or iOS platforms.
- Create an account in the app and follow the registration process to link the tracker device to your profile.
- Attach the tracker securely to your dog’s collar, ensuring it fits comfortably without being too loose or tight.
- Set up safe zones (geo-fences) within the app by marking your property boundaries or preferred walking areas.
- Test the tracker’s real-time location feature by observing live updates within different parts of your property or open areas.
- Adjust notification settings to receive alerts when your dog leaves the safe zones or the tracker’s battery is low.
Tips for effective use include regularly checking the device’s battery status, updating the app and firmware to benefit from improvements, and familiarizing yourself with the app’s functionalities before heading out. In rural areas, verify cellular coverage or satellite connectivity, as some devices may require these to operate optimally.
By following these steps, you can confidently use a GPS dog tracker to enjoy outdoor adventures with your Golden Retriever while maintaining constant awareness of their whereabouts.
Comparing top gps dog trackers suited for Goldens in rural environments
When selecting the best GPS dog tracker for Goldens in rural environments, it’s important to compare features, durability, and value to find a device that meets your specific needs. Several top models stand out due to their reliability and performance in wide-open areas.
The Garmin Alpha 100 is highly regarded for its robust GPS accuracy and long-range tracking capability, making it ideal for vast rural spaces. It includes two-way communication and a durable, waterproof design built for outdoor adventures. The device operates through the Garmin Explore app, available on Android and iOS.
Whistle GO Explore offers excellent health monitoring alongside GPS tracking. It uses cellular networks to provide real-time location updates and includes a waterproof, lightweight collar attachment. This tracker is favored for its user-friendly mobile app and versatile features tailored for active dogs.
The Tractive GPS Tracker for Dogs is another popular choice, providing live tracking and virtual fence alerts. Known for its affordability and ease of use, it connects via 3G or 4G cellular networks and offers international coverage, which is advantageous for rural areas near borders or in wide territories.
Link AKC Smart Collar combines GPS tracking with temperature alerts and activity monitoring, enhancing your dog’s safety and wellness. Its sleek design and seamless integration with a dedicated app make it a solid option for owners looking for comprehensive features.
Fi Smart Dog Collar focuses on long battery life and reliable GPS tracking. It provides sophisticated location tracking on a detailed map and sends instant notifications if your dog leaves designated safe zones. Its durable, waterproof design is built for active breeds like Goldens.
These trackers vary in price, subscription requirements, and app functionalities, making it important to assess your budget and needs. Consider factors like battery life, range, comfort, and additional health monitoring features when choosing the best GPS tracker for your Golden Retriever in a rural environment.

FAQ – Common Questions About GPS Dog Trackers for Goldens
Why is a GPS tracker important for Golden Retrievers in rural areas?
GPS trackers help keep track of your Golden Retriever’s location in vast and open rural areas, reducing the risk of losing your dog and enhancing their safety.
What features should I look for in a GPS dog tracker?
Look for accuracy, real-time tracking, long battery life, durability, waterproof design, geo-fencing, and a user-friendly mobile app for the best experience.
How do I set up my GPS dog tracker?
Charge the device fully, download the official app, create an account, attach the tracker securely to your dog’s collar, set safe zones, and test live tracking before use.
Can GPS trackers monitor my dog’s health?
Some GPS trackers, like Whistle GO Explore and Link AKC Smart Collar, include features for activity monitoring and health tracking alongside location services.
Are GPS dog trackers reliable in rural environments?
Yes, but reliability depends on the tracker’s connectivity options such as cellular or satellite networks and battery life, which are crucial for rural coverage.
Do GPS dog trackers require a subscription?
Many trackers require a subscription for cellular service to access real-time location updates and alerts. It’s important to review the costs and plans before purchasing.
